Jury in Offaly rape trial continue deliberations
The jury in the trial of an Offaly farmer charged with raping and sexually assaulting his niece over an eight year period has started its deliberations at the Central Criminal Court.
The man pleaded not guilty at the start of his trial to a total of 44 charges - 27 of rape on dates from 1992 to 1998, and 17 of indecent and sexual assault on dates from 1990 to 1995.
